In the quest for effective laser removal machines, precision and efficacy are paramount. According to a report by Grand View Research, the global demand for laser removal technology is projected to exceed $5 billion by 2027, indicating a significant market for robust solutions. The effectiveness of these machines largely depends on their wavelength and laser type; for instance, the Nd:YAG laser, known for treating tattoo removals, operates at a wavelength of 1064 nm, delivering impressive results with minimal skin trauma. Meanwhile, the Alexandrite laser, effective for hair removal, utilizes a wavelength of 755 nm, targeting melanin in the hair follicles with high accuracy.
Moreover, studies highlight the importance of choosing machines with advanced cooling systems to enhance patient comfort and treatment outcomes. A clinical evaluation published in the Journal of Dermatological Treatment found that lasers equipped with integrated cooling technology had a 30% higher patient satisfaction rate compared to those without. When it comes to laser removal machines, understanding the technology behind them is crucial for making an informed purchase. Each machine offers distinctive features that cater to various skin types and conditions, ensuring optimal results. The most advanced systems employ multiple wavelengths, allowing practitioners to target a wide range of pigmentation issues, tattoos, and hair types. The efficiency of these machines largely depends on their ability to deliver precise energy to the desired depth of skin, minimizing damage to surrounding tissues.
Safety is another vital factor that buyers should consider when comparing laser removal machines. Features like built-in cooling systems, adjustable energy settings, and user-friendly interfaces enhance the safety and comfort of the treatment process. Machines equipped with advanced safety protocols can adapt their performance in real-time, providing a personalized experience based on the client’s skin sensitivity and treatment goals. By emphasizing technology and safety in their design, top laser removal machines not only enhance treatment efficacy but also ensure a more comfortable experience for users.
